    The Anaheim Pepper is an 80 days Heirloom. It is considered mildly hot, however, if you let it to red expect it to go up quite a bit in the heat. It is a long tapered pungent, medium-thick pepper. Green maturing to red. Used mainly as a stuffing pepper. SHU of 900 to 3,500.

    They are the chile made famous by Ortega, which has been selling them as a canned fire-roasted chile pepper since 1897.

    Fish peppers are really pretty with variegated coloring.  It starts green with white areas, then the white goes yellow and then orange, and eventually, the entire pepper turns red. The Fish Pepper has a Scoville of between 5,000 and 50,000 units being a medium-hot pepper.  The pepper originated in Baltimore and was used to make a white pepper sauce that was served with fish or seafood. Its roots reach back into the 19 century.  The pepper can be grown in containers or in the ground. It is not huge in stature but puts out a lot of 2-inch peppers.

    The Guajillo pepper is known to be on the sweet side of spice.  It has a Scoville unit of only 2500-5000 which makes it 3 times milder than jalapeno peppers.  These are often found dried and used in traditional dishes.  Finding them fresh is a rare thing indeed. This pepper is the second most popular in Mexico.  This pepper is used in Mexican Mole Sauce and Harissa Chili Paste.   This is a 75-day heirloom pepper.  The pods are between 3 and 5 inches long.

    The Caribbean Red Habanero is a classic habanero with a Scoville rating of 300,000 to 445,000.  It has the classic habanero taste but a little hotter than the orange variety.  The plants get about 30 inches high and mature in about 90 days.  The fruit is about 1 to 2 inches in size.
